diff --git a/source/native-plugins/Makefile b/source/native-plugins/Makefile index 67b5b7728..767697d37 100644 --- a/source/native-plugins/Makefile +++ b/source/native-plugins/Makefile @@ -25,9 +25,6 @@ TARGETS = \ # --------------------------------------------------------------------------------------------------------------------- # Set objects -# --------------------------------------------------------------------------------------------------------------------- -# Simple plugins - OBJS = \ $(OBJDIR)/bypass.c.o \ $(OBJDIR)/lfo.c.o \ @@ -100,6 +97,6 @@ $(OBJDIR)/%.cpp.o: %.cpp # --------------------------------------------------------------------------------------------------------------------- --include $(OBJS:%.o=%.d) +-include $(OBJS_all:%.o=%.d) # --------------------------------------------------------------------------------------------------------------------- diff --git a/source/native-plugins/external/Makefile b/source/native-plugins/external/Makefile index 6138a587a..73cb6a4db 100644 --- a/source/native-plugins/external/Makefile +++ b/source/native-plugins/external/Makefile @@ -95,66 +95,66 @@ zynaddsubfx/UI/%.h: zynaddsubfx/UI/%.fl # --------------------------------------------------------------------------------------------------------------------- -$(OBJDIR)/distrho-3bandeq.cpp.o: $(EXTERNAL_DIR)distrho-3bandeq.cpp +$(OBJDIR)/distrho-3bandeq.cpp.o: external/distrho-3bandeq.cpp -@mkdir -p $(OBJDIR) @echo "Compiling $<" @$(CXX) $< $(BUILD_CXX_FLAGS) $(DPF_FLAGS) -DDISTRHO_NAMESPACE=d3BandEQ -Idistrho-3bandeq -c -o $@ -$(OBJDIR)/distrho-3bandsplitter.cpp.o: distrho-3bandsplitter.cpp +$(OBJDIR)/distrho-3bandsplitter.cpp.o: external/distrho-3bandsplitter.cpp -@mkdir -p $(OBJDIR) @echo "Compiling $<" @$(CXX) $< $(BUILD_CXX_FLAGS) $(DPF_FLAGS) -DDISTRHO_NAMESPACE=d3BandSplitter -Idistrho-3bandsplitter -c -o $@ -$(OBJDIR)/distrho-kars.cpp.o: distrho-kars.cpp +$(OBJDIR)/distrho-kars.cpp.o: external/distrho-kars.cpp -@mkdir -p $(OBJDIR) @echo "Compiling $<" @$(CXX) $< $(BUILD_CXX_FLAGS) $(DPF_FLAGS) -DDISTRHO_NAMESPACE=dKars -Idistrho-kars -c -o $@ -$(OBJDIR)/distrho-nekobi.cpp.o: distrho-nekobi.cpp +$(OBJDIR)/distrho-nekobi.cpp.o: external/distrho-nekobi.cpp -@mkdir -p $(OBJDIR) @echo "Compiling $<" @$(CXX) $< $(BUILD_CXX_FLAGS) $(DPF_FLAGS) -DDISTRHO_NAMESPACE=dNekobi -Idistrho-nekobi -w -c -o $@ -$(OBJDIR)/distrho-pingpongpan.cpp.o: distrho-pingpongpan.cpp +$(OBJDIR)/distrho-pingpongpan.cpp.o: external/distrho-pingpongpan.cpp -@mkdir -p $(OBJDIR) @echo "Compiling $<" @$(CXX) $< $(BUILD_CXX_FLAGS) $(DPF_FLAGS) -DDISTRHO_NAMESPACE=dPingPongPan -Idistrho-pingpongpan -c -o $@ -$(OBJDIR)/distrho-prom.cpp.o: distrho-prom.cpp +$(OBJDIR)/distrho-prom.cpp.o: external/distrho-prom.cpp -@mkdir -p $(OBJDIR) @echo "Compiling $<" @$(CXX) $< $(BUILD_CXX_FLAGS) $(DPF_FLAGS) $(PROJECTM_FLAGS) -DDISTRHO_NAMESPACE=dProM -Idistrho-prom -c -o $@ # --------------------------------------------------------------------------------------------------------------------- -$(OBJDIR)/distrho-vectorjuice.cpp.o: distrho-vectorjuice.cpp +$(OBJDIR)/distrho-vectorjuice.cpp.o: external/distrho-vectorjuice.cpp -@mkdir -p $(OBJDIR) @echo "Compiling $<" @$(CXX) $< $(BUILD_CXX_FLAGS) $(DPF_FLAGS) -DDISTRHO_NAMESPACE=dVectorJuice -Idistrho-vectorjuice -c -o $@ -$(OBJDIR)/distrho-wobblejuice.cpp.o: distrho-wobblejuice.cpp +$(OBJDIR)/distrho-wobblejuice.cpp.o: external/distrho-wobblejuice.cpp -@mkdir -p $(OBJDIR) @echo "Compiling $<" @$(CXX) $< $(BUILD_CXX_FLAGS) $(DPF_FLAGS) -DDISTRHO_NAMESPACE=dWobbleJuice -Idistrho-wobblejuice -c -o $@ # --------------------------------------------------------------------------------------------------------------------- -$(OBJDIR)/zynaddsubfx-fx.cpp.o: zynaddsubfx-fx.cpp +$(OBJDIR)/zynaddsubfx-fx.cpp.o: external/zynaddsubfx-fx.cpp -@mkdir -p $(OBJDIR) @echo "Compiling $<" @$(CXX) $< $(BUILD_CXX_FLAGS) $(ZYN_DSP_FLAGS) -c -o $@ -$(OBJDIR)/zynaddsubfx-synth.cpp.o: zynaddsubfx-synth.cpp +$(OBJDIR)/zynaddsubfx-synth.cpp.o: external/zynaddsubfx-synth.cpp -@mkdir -p $(OBJDIR) @echo "Compiling $<" @$(CXX) $< $(BUILD_CXX_FLAGS) $(ZYN_DSP_FLAGS) -Wno-unused-parameter -c -o $@ -$(OBJDIR)/zynaddsubfx-src.cpp.o: zynaddsubfx-src.cpp +$(OBJDIR)/zynaddsubfx-src.cpp.o: external/zynaddsubfx-src.cpp -@mkdir -p $(OBJDIR) @echo "Compiling $<" @$(CXX) $< $(BUILD_CXX_FLAGS) $(ZYN_DSP_FLAGS) -Wno-unused-parameter -Wno-unused-variable -c -o $@ -$(OBJDIR)/zynaddsubfx-ui.cpp.o: zynaddsubfx-ui.cpp $(ZYN_UI_FILES_H) $(ZYN_UI_FILES_CPP) +$(OBJDIR)/zynaddsubfx-ui.cpp.o: external/zynaddsubfx-ui.cpp $(ZYN_UI_FILES_H) $(ZYN_UI_FILES_CPP) -@mkdir -p $(OBJDIR) @echo "Compiling $<" @$(CXX) $< $(BUILD_CXX_FLAGS) $(ZYN_UI_FLAGS) -Wno-unused-parameter -Wno-unused-variable -c -o $@ diff --git a/source/native-plugins/distrho-3bandeq.cpp b/source/native-plugins/external/distrho-3bandeq.cpp similarity index 100% rename from source/native-plugins/distrho-3bandeq.cpp rename to source/native-plugins/external/distrho-3bandeq.cpp diff --git a/source/native-plugins/distrho-3bandsplitter.cpp b/source/native-plugins/external/distrho-3bandsplitter.cpp similarity index 100% rename from source/native-plugins/distrho-3bandsplitter.cpp rename to source/native-plugins/external/distrho-3bandsplitter.cpp diff --git a/source/native-plugins/distrho-kars.cpp b/source/native-plugins/external/distrho-kars.cpp similarity index 100% rename from source/native-plugins/distrho-kars.cpp rename to source/native-plugins/external/distrho-kars.cpp diff --git a/source/native-plugins/distrho-nekobi.cpp b/source/native-plugins/external/distrho-nekobi.cpp similarity index 100% rename from source/native-plugins/distrho-nekobi.cpp rename to source/native-plugins/external/distrho-nekobi.cpp diff --git a/source/native-plugins/distrho-pingpongpan.cpp b/source/native-plugins/external/distrho-pingpongpan.cpp similarity index 100% rename from source/native-plugins/distrho-pingpongpan.cpp rename to source/native-plugins/external/distrho-pingpongpan.cpp diff --git a/source/native-plugins/distrho-prom.cpp b/source/native-plugins/external/distrho-prom.cpp similarity index 100% rename from source/native-plugins/distrho-prom.cpp rename to source/native-plugins/external/distrho-prom.cpp diff --git a/source/native-plugins/distrho-vectorjuice.cpp b/source/native-plugins/external/distrho-vectorjuice.cpp similarity index 100% rename from source/native-plugins/distrho-vectorjuice.cpp rename to source/native-plugins/external/distrho-vectorjuice.cpp diff --git a/source/native-plugins/distrho-wobblejuice.cpp b/source/native-plugins/external/distrho-wobblejuice.cpp similarity index 100% rename from source/native-plugins/distrho-wobblejuice.cpp rename to source/native-plugins/external/distrho-wobblejuice.cpp diff --git a/source/native-plugins/zynaddsubfx-fx.cpp b/source/native-plugins/external/zynaddsubfx-fx.cpp similarity index 100% rename from source/native-plugins/zynaddsubfx-fx.cpp rename to source/native-plugins/external/zynaddsubfx-fx.cpp diff --git a/source/native-plugins/zynaddsubfx-src.cpp b/source/native-plugins/external/zynaddsubfx-src.cpp similarity index 100% rename from source/native-plugins/zynaddsubfx-src.cpp rename to source/native-plugins/external/zynaddsubfx-src.cpp diff --git a/source/native-plugins/zynaddsubfx-synth.cpp b/source/native-plugins/external/zynaddsubfx-synth.cpp similarity index 100% rename from source/native-plugins/zynaddsubfx-synth.cpp rename to source/native-plugins/external/zynaddsubfx-synth.cpp diff --git a/source/native-plugins/zynaddsubfx-ui.cpp b/source/native-plugins/external/zynaddsubfx-ui.cpp similarity index 100% rename from source/native-plugins/zynaddsubfx-ui.cpp rename to source/native-plugins/external/zynaddsubfx-ui.cpp